WebThese animals under the phylum Hemichordata have a primitive type nervous system which mainly consists of a subepidermal nerve plexus. Moreover, they have a hollow dorsal nerve cord. Reproduction is mainly sexual and the sexes are separate, gonads are one to several pairs. Fertilization is external. WebApr 6, 2024 · Hemichordata is a phylum of ocean deuterostome organisms that is sometimes referred to as the echinoderms' sister group. Enteropneusta (acorn worms) and Pterobranchia are the two primary classes that occur in the Lower or Middle Cambrian. Planctosphaeroidea, a third class, is only recognized from the larva of one species, …

Together with the Echinoderms, the hemichordates form the Ambulacraria, which are the closest extant phylogenetic relatives of chordates. Thus these marine worms are of great interest for the study of the origins of chordate development.
